When college websites say either SAT or ACT required do they really mean either, or will I be penalized for only submitting a certain score?
Generally, they really mean either. However, check with your counselor for information about specific schools. Odds are he or she will have worked with that schools application process previously. It is always best to call the admissions office of the college or university that interests you. It helps your chances if you prove that you are interested in this way. College admissions offices actually keep track of students who called for any reason.
